Inter Milan Fails to Topple Napoli After Narrow Loss to Juventus

Malanginspirasi.com – Inter Milan failed to dethrone Napoli from the top of the Serie A standings as they succumbed to a narrow 0-1 defeat against Juventus at the Allianz Stadium on February 16, 2025. This match held significant importance for both teams, with Inter aiming to reclaim the league lead and Juventus seeking to break into the top four.

The match started intensely, with Inter creating early chances. Michele Di Gregorio made a crucial save against Mehdi Taremi’s overhead kick, and shortly after, Dumfries failed to convert a rebound.

Juventus responded with their own opportunities, but Yann Sommer was quick to deny a strike from Nico Gonzalez.

As the game progressed, Dumfries nearly opened the scoring for Inter, only to hit the post with his attempt. The return of Andrea Cambiaso and the introduction of Marcus Thuram provided Inter with additional attacking options, despite both players still grappling with fitness issues.

The breakthrough came in the 74th minute when Juventus’ Randal Kolo Muani skillfully maneuvered past defenders and assisted Conceicao, who coolly slotted the ball into the net.

As the match progressed, Inter sought to equalize, with both Marcus Thuram and Kolo Muani attempting to breach Juventus’s resolute defense. However, their endeavors were thwarted by a determined Juventus side, which successfully preserved their lead until the final whistle.

The outcome of this match marked Inter Milan’s third defeat of the season, leaving them with 54 points, just two points adrift of Napoli..

Meanwhile, Juventus’s victory propelled them into the top four, effectively pushing Lazio down, as they now boast an equal points tally of 46, enhanced by a superior goal difference.
